How To Be Productive When Learning PTE Online? 10 Simple Tips

How to be productive when learning PTE online

Plan Your Study Schedule

Planning your study schedule is the first and most important thing you need when you want to learn anything. 

It’s not just a random idea in your head, but a clear, doable schedule that fits your daily life.

You can try to set a fixed time every day to study. 

For example, one hour before lunch or two hours after dinner. 

When you keep your timing consistent, your brain gets used to it and focuses more easily.

You don’t have to study all day to make progress. 

What really matters is that you’re studying with intention. 

Even a short, focused session is better than hours of distracted learning.

Create A Dedicated Study Space

Have you ever tried studying on your bed and ended up falling asleep? 

Many students have been there. 

Your study space really affects your concentration.

You should pick a comfortable corner and keep it tidy. 

You don’t need anything fancy, but just a table, a good chair, and maybe a cup of tea or coffee. 

When your brain connects that space with focus time, it becomes easier to switch into study mode.

Take Notes Manually

Typing is faster, but writing things down with a pen helps you remember so much better. 

When you take notes by hand, your brain processes the information more deeply.

You should try summarizing what you learn in your own words. 

For example, you can write down new words, grammar patterns, or mistakes you often make. 

Not only does it make your notes look perfect, but it also makes your brain active while learning. 

Use Music To Enhance Focus

Some people like total silence. 

But for others, a bit of background music makes studying more enjoyable. 

You can try soft piano, classical music, or acoustic instrumentals. 

And remember to avoid songs with lyrics, as they may steal your attention.

You should play around and see what works best for you. 

If music helps you stay calm and focused, then use it to your advantage.

Assess Your Strengths And Weaknesses

Before diving into endless practice questions, it’s important to know where you stand. 

Maybe you’re doing great in reading, but find speaking stressful. 

Or maybe your writing score needs more attention.

It’s always best to spend some time reviewing your previous results or practice tests. 

Once you understand your weak areas, focus on improving them instead of repeating what you’re already good at. 

That’s how real progress happens.

Manage Your Study Time Effectively

Studying longer doesn’t always mean studying better. 

You can easily sit in front of your screen for three hours and still not learn much if your mind keeps wandering. 

Instead, you should:

  • Study in short, focused sessions instead of long hours.
  • Try the Pomodoro method: study for 25 minutes, then take a 5-minute break.
  • Avoid multitasking, as it can make your brain tired more quickly.
  • Focus on one task at a time and give it your full attention.

Seek Feedback And Guidance

Learning online can feel lonely sometimes, but you don’t have to do it all alone. 

Feedback helps you grow so much faster. Below are some useful tips:

  • Work with a tutor or join an online PTE class so teachers can correct your mistakes.
  • Record your answers and ask for feedback from teachers.
  • Study with friends who are also preparing for the PTE test.
  • Discuss your weak points together so you can improve day by day.

Mix Up Study Activities

Doing the same thing every day can make studying feel boring and repetitive. So mix it up! 

You can listen to English podcasts while cooking, watch YouTube videos about PTE tips, or practice speaking in front of a mirror.

Some days, focus more on listening or reading. 

Other days, you can challenge yourself with a timed Writing or Speaking test.

Changing your activities keeps your mind active and helps you learn faster without getting bored.

Practice Under Exam Conditions

One big mistake many students make is practicing too comfortably. 

They pause the audio, recheck questions, or look up words immediately. 

But in the real PTE tests, you don’t have time to do that.

So it’s a good idea to practice as if you’re already taking the exam. 

It’s best to set a timer and not pause anything. 

You need to sit down and finish the whole test in one go. 

It might feel intense at first, but you’ll get used to the pace and feel more confident on test day.

Maintain Consistency And Take Breaks

Consistency is everything. 

You don’t have to be perfect, but you have to keep going. 

Even if you only study for an hour a day, it still builds up over time. 

And don’t forget to rest. 

Your brain needs time to recharge. 

You can go for a walk, stretch, or do something relaxing after studying. 

The goal isn’t to study nonstop, but to stay motivated long-term. 

Just remember that it’s a marathon, not a sprint.

FAQs

What Is The Best Way To Study PTE Online?

The best way is to combine daily practice with review sessions. 

You should try to balance all 4 skills: Listening, Reading, Writing, and Speaking, and take full mock tests to track your progress. 

How Long Does It Take To Prepare PTE?

It depends on your current level, but most students need between 3 and 4 months of consistent practice to reach their target score. 

The more time you dedicate each day, the faster you’ll improve.

What Are Some Common Challenges During Online PTE Learning?

The biggest challenges are distractions and a lack of motivation. 

Sometimes you might feel tired of studying alone or unsure if you’re improving or not. 

When that happens, you can change your routine, join an online study group, or take a break to recharge.
